summaryrefslogtreecommitdiffstats
AgeCommit message (Collapse)AuthorFilesLines
2024-02-12Release cps3.3.12jenkins-releng23-23/+23
2024-02-12CPS release update for montrealArpit Singh4-1405/+1544
Montreal branch update with delta feature Issue-ID: CPS-2085 Signed-off-by: Arpit Singh <as00745003@techmahindra.com> Change-Id: I2b579b64e52251722578e8e6ff8a5554181019f0
2024-02-08Fix: Documentation for Delta FeatureArpit Singh1-0/+6
Issue-ID: CPS-2074 Signed-off-by: Arpit Singh <as00745003@techmahindra.com> Change-Id: Ib32b4c75f7eb5402367f69a077c447a3eb062b0b (cherry picked from commit 4d42d689af7cd96770143bddf1e79ae638ac1989)
2024-02-08Documentation update for Delta FeatureArpit Singh4-0/+118
- Documantation about Delta Feature - Documantation on API 1: Delta between 2 anchors Issue-ID: CPS-2056 Signed-off-by: Arpit Singh <as00745003@techmahindra.com> Change-Id: I9841ea166f7c57ab6218fefa5b577b4053e39490
2024-02-08CPS 1824: Delta Between 2 Anchors release notesArpit Singh2-18/+17
Updated release notes for Delta Feature Issue-ID: CPS-1824 Signed-off-by: Arpit Singh <as00745003@techmahindra.com> Change-Id: I1c2403391e85aec6a9e34f0ff616c17b100bf6a9
2024-02-08CPS Delta API: Update action for delta serviceArpit Singh6-71/+261
- Added code for Update action in Delta service - added method to get updated Leaf data: getUpdatedLeavesBetweenSourceAndTargetDataNode - added method to compare Leaf data common in source and target data node - added method to process leaves unique to target data node - added method to compare leaves: compareLeaves - added method to store updated data to a DeltaReport: addUpdatedLeavesToDeltaReport - Added corresponding testware Issue-ID: CPS-1824 Signed-off-by: Arpit Singh <as00745003@techmahindra.com> Change-Id: I3de07ea3227988784a0892f6a92c238ecf00a7fa
2024-02-08CPS Delta API 1: Delta between 2 anchorsArpit Singh19-5/+878
- CPS Delta Feature Part 1: To find delta between two anchors - created new endpoint deltaByDataspaceAndAnchors - endpoint to take dataspaceName, source anchor, target anchor, xpath, descendants as input - added new service CpsDeltaService - added method to find delta between DataNodes: getDeltaReport - added method to find removed data nodes: getRemovedDeltaReports - added method to get Added DataNodes: getAddedDeltaReports - added method to get Map of xpath to DataNode: convertToXPathToDataNodesMap - added a POJO for delta report - Added new JSON data for delta feature testing - Added groovy test files CpsDeltaServiceImplSpec and DeltaReportBuilderSpec - code related to update operation, will be added in separate commit Issue-ID: CPS-1824 Signed-off-by: Arpit Singh <as00745003@techmahindra.com> Change-Id: I313f0f71d04b03878be7643f709d8af1aa6df6ba
2024-02-08Update Architecture rule to add cache packagedanielhanrahan2-2/+5
- Modify test to allow org.onap.cps.cache package to access CPS classes - Update archunit to avoid exceptions during build related to Java 17 Issue-ID: CPS-1958 Signed-off-by: danielhanrahan <daniel.hanrahan@est.tech> Change-Id: If74dd897b8e41b83e41ea2a35e087ee56beb3088 (cherry picked from commit ed9d179947325bbb9b81378b469341d023b46cd8)
2024-02-08Cps Data csit enhancedmpriyank1-1/+6
- instead of relying on the sequence of elements , using the contains operation to assert the result Issue-ID: CPS-2075 Change-Id: Ifbd3c601cc48148d0c4d7ce47301dbfb5184e1de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2024-02-07Fixes for montreal releasempriyank5-5/+6
- updating the DOCKER REPO port to pull images from the read only repo - update the csit dmi plugin image to 1.4.0 - add six as dependency for csit - added legacy-ouput flag to the csit run-csit file - commented cps-subscription csit test Issue-ID: CPS-2075 Change-Id: I00dffdf305f634841208dade210cac499c61615d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-29Bump CPS to 3.3.12 for montrealmpriyank25-25/+52
- bumped the cps version to 3.3.12-SNAPSHOT for further changes. - Also updated the documentations for the next release Issue-ID: CPS-1981 Change-Id: I8e463c7873ae28e57fe8fb7f24c6e15b579f9503 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-29Add maven container yaml for montrealmpriyank1-0/+8
- adding container yaml for montreal to release 3.3.11 Issue-ID: CPS-1981 Change-Id: If1d76bb8f894cc1b00f5d7e4ba357264eb756689 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-29Maven stage yaml for montrealmpriyank1-0/+4
- maven stage file for montreal to release 3.3.11 Issue-ID: CPS-1981 Change-Id: I057bc0167100a992aa8854c88089763ea4de7943 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-29Bumping CPS version to 3.3.11-SNAPSHOTmpriyank25-28/+28
- 3.3.10 version became unusable because of a bad commit so skipping that. Issue-ID: CPS-1981 Change-Id: I740e432608356d1b542a759dd11560d89d884001 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-29Release notes updated for 3.3.10mpriyank1-0/+1
Issue-ID: CPS-1981 Change-Id: Ic79ba6127c6b343efe69625b50c12464b138ea73 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-28Return permit-uri from root to securtyegernug2-2/+3
In Springboot 3.0 an error was observed with security.permit-uri throwing a PatternParseException. This appears to be fixed in 3.1.2 Issue-ID: CPS-1875 Signed-off-by: egernug <gerard.nugent@est.tech> Change-Id: I8dd4f66868a5cc4db636d77f123ad5dbbd61f4b4 (cherry picked from commit ff598422ebf5bb21bb66eddc68042ebc0512b77d)
2023-11-09Remove CPS-Temporal from RTDToineSiebelink10-41/+6
- Remove CPS-Temporal references - Removed never implemented interface such as AA&I - Updated diagrams accordingly - moved all images to _static folder - restored -W flag for tox and link-check section so errors will lead to build failures! Issue-ID:CPS-1927 Signed-off-by: ToineSiebelink <toine.siebelink@est.tech> Change-Id: Ib291b0904472dd32b5458dec3c78391cd1c018d9 (cherry picked from commit d0e4a9c41e3beac0636df7c04b1ba9d619866afc)
2023-11-08Update gitreview for CPS in montrealmpriyank1-2/+1
- gitreview file to point to montreal branch now instead of master Issue-ID: CPS-1936 Change-Id: I58380086f2669c94386173e51a66102da8dc73e8 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-06Bump cps to 3.3.10-SNAPSHOTmpriyank25-25/+52
- bump cps to 3.3.10-SNAPSHOT and update the docs Issue-ID: CPS-1954 Change-Id: Id62f59d4b3c42ea6f791fad85f0700089e3125b9 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-06Add container yaml for cpsmpriyank1-0/+8
- container yaml for cps 3.3.9 Issue-ID: CPS-1952 Change-Id: I68f85c6881d9c1f9c91e6b54db6d80c1d030a8d4 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-06Adding maven stage yaml for releasempriyank1-0/+4
- Adding maven stage yaml file for releasing 3.3.9 version of CPS Issue-ID: CPS-1952 Change-Id: If106d29aa730f222f8d4ce288a2f31032be5bd27 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-06Step 1 and 2 of release processmpriyank3-2/+14
- Sync the openapi docs and the release notes - Also commenting a test scenario coz of unrelated failure. will be fixed later Issue-ID: CPS-1949 Change-Id: I27c955e569acdfe1f699f345fa583f7bce95e76a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-06[BUG] CPS NCMP management endpoints updatempriyank9-23/+17
- CPS and NCMP management endpoint updated from /manage to /actuator now - The management port is same as application port now - CSIT test cases update - Update in Security params to allow the changed URL. - Admin guid update - Release notes updated - Local docker-compose and prometheus updated Issue-ID: CPS-1923 Change-Id: I013d35fd96d393dec8cf067bbeae0f92b6b8d8db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-11-03[BUG] Set Hazelcast class loaderdanielhanrahan1-0/+1
ClassNotFoundException is being thrown during CM-handle registration when running the cps-application JAR. This fixes the issue by using the class loader for the CPS classes. Issue-ID: CPS-1933 Signed-off-by: danielhanrahan <daniel.hanrahan@est.tech> Change-Id: I02e2d19d9f668f0c4af36e9061e68f9b9ddb9434
2023-11-03Merge "Handling Yang module upgrade error scenarios"Priyank Maheshwari7-51/+108
2023-11-02Merge "Add trust level notification schema"Toine Siebelink1-0/+56
2023-11-02Handling Yang module upgrade error scenariossourabh_sourabh7-51/+108
- cm handle not ready, not found , invalid id Issue-ID: CPS-1802 Signed-off-by: sourabh_sourabh <sourabh.sourabh@est.tech> Change-Id: I2039faa44abbda17237e7c2dc085b4ac775c2039 Signed-off-by: sourabh_sourabh <sourabh.sourabh@est.tech>
2023-11-02Add trust level notification schemaJvD_Ericsson1-0/+56
Issue-ID: CPS-1910 Signed-off-by: JvD_Ericsson <jeff.van.dam@est.tech> Change-Id: If7265e0020b2ba247aaf64c9c0820e3cfdb23583
2023-11-02Initial Registration with trustLevel on NCMPseanbeirne6-24/+57
- Updated NcmpServiceCmHandle class to include registration trustLevel Issue-ID: CPS-1902 Signed-off-by: seanbeirne <sean.beirne@est.tech> Change-Id: I7c97928f5cdd82f3036a57ea5f0c149e2872f4f1
2023-10-27Merge "[BUG] CPS NCMP Change extension in health check URL"Sourabh Sourabh1-2/+3
2023-10-26Merge "Update return body of RestOutputCMHandle"Toine Siebelink3-95/+120
2023-10-26[BUG] CPS NCMP Change extension in health check URLhalil.cakal1-2/+3
- Align URL extension to default actuator URL Issue-ID: CPS-1922 Change-Id: Ifaa1eb32f3c6be5c48a63c4e360c27353d0e5e0f Signed-off-by: halil.cakal <halil.cakal@est.tech>
2023-10-25Update return body of RestOutputCMHandleemaclee3-95/+120
Issue-ID: CPS-1869 Signed-off-by: emaclee <lee.anjella.macabuhay@est.tech> Change-Id: I946db9e6785fc50775d1c5ff18e7462e8bad9af6
2023-10-23Introduce and use new Hazelcast map pt. 2sourabh_sourabh21-134/+263
- modified ModuleSyncService - created ModuleSetTagCacheConfig and tests - ensure both Create and Upgrade cm Handle use cases work - Moved inventory pkg to its right patha as production code. Issue-ID: CPS-1859 Signed-off-by: leventecsanyi <levente.csanyi@est.tech> Change-Id: I173dcd81fe2e74d86d85365b2ead461302cad974 Signed-off-by: sourabh_sourabh <sourabh.sourabh@est.tech>
2023-10-19Code coverage: Update YANG schema set using moduleSetTagsourabh_sourabh7-27/+122
- Code coverage is increased to 98. - New groovy test is added to cover new code. Issue-ID: CPS-1798 Signed-off-by: sourabh_sourabh <sourabh.sourabh@est.tech> Change-Id: Ia979be3f43ec8e4bbf6f8cb66a8a5e748118f19b Signed-off-by: sourabh_sourabh <sourabh.sourabh@est.tech>
2023-10-18Merging of Subscription schemasmpriyank4-13/+119
- Added new schema from DMI Plugin to NCMP - Added new schema from NCMP to the clients - Renamed existing schemas as per the conventions - Removed the merge keyword from the schemas and naming. Still the package will have merge keyword which will eventually be removed when we remove the old code Issue-ID: CPS-1905 Issue-ID: CPS-1906 Change-Id: I1f8c35e7f6baa25346d9527d58e20bba7f0dddeb Signed-off-by: mpriyank <priyank.maheshwari@est.tech>
2023-10-18Fix Sonar code smellsemaclee2-14/+11
- Update deprecated methods in webSecurityCOnfig - Remove 'deprecated' tag on methods that are to be removed in EventsPublisher as they are still being used, methods with deprecated tag (for removal) must not be used Issue-ID: CPS-89 Signed-off-by: emaclee <lee.anjella.macabuhay@est.tech> Change-Id: I104d4b3e362d22bb7fc020580de6cb4f390e54c9
2023-10-17Merge "[BUG] Fix for Swagger UI generation"Toine Siebelink6-7/+45
2023-10-17Merge "Add memory usage to integration tests [UPDATED]"Toine Siebelink12-201/+273
2023-10-17[BUG] Fix for Swagger UI generationegernug6-7/+45
Issue-ID: CPS-1913 Signed-off-by: egernug <gerard.nugent@est.tech> Change-Id: Ib8a1b5fddc9957bd371fbb4dc54d018b25af3679
2023-10-16Merge "Clean up Dependencies"Toine Siebelink6-181/+183
2023-10-16Merge "Adding NCMP Stubs documentation"Toine Siebelink5-18/+247
2023-10-16Merge "Add NCMP Stub documentation to RTD"Toine Siebelink9-15/+137
2023-10-16Merge "Add withTrustLevel condition to CmHandle Query API"Toine Siebelink22-146/+317
2023-10-16Adding NCMP Stubs documentationwaqas.ikram5-18/+247
Issue-ID: CPS-1858 Change-Id: I90017d9d9c6e937292e9de45c0e8228357414e16 Signed-off-by: waqas.ikram <waqas.ikram@est.tech>
2023-10-16Add NCMP Stub documentation to RTDToineSiebelink9-15/+137
-add new pages fot Stubs -fixed spleeting erros -added file with accepatbel cps terms for spell check Issue-ID: CPS-1858 Signed-off-by: ToineSiebelink <toine.siebelink@est.tech> Change-Id: I71fdeb29b015067d208e404bed8ac53b03810c00
2023-10-16Clean up Dependenciesegernug6-181/+183
Clean up of dependencies into logical orders and compile/test statuses Issue-ID: CPS-1873 Signed-off-by: egernug <gerard.nugent@est.tech> Change-Id: I90ad49b7f1362e8f5b7006b85013c0bdf1b4d4ef
2023-10-13Merge "Update Subscription Event Schemas for merge"Priyank Maheshwari2-0/+168
2023-10-13Update Subscription Event Schemas for mergeseanbeirne2-0/+168
Issue-ID: CPS-1877 Signed-off-by: seanbeirne <sean.beirne@est.tech> Change-Id: I7545b1efb71d5032fad31200e874481cf1efe5b0
2023-10-12Add withTrustLevel condition to CmHandle Query APIhalil.cakal22-146/+317
- Change untrustworthyCmHandleSet with trustLevelPerCmHandleMap - Change trust level cache config accordingly - Change device heartbet consumer accordingly - Add json schema for device trust level - Add with_trust_level enum into cm handle query conditions - Add query cm handle by trustlevel function to cm handle queries - Add query cm handle by trustlevel service to network cm proxy cm handle service - Add unit tests and fix code smells Issue-ID: CPS-1864 Change-Id: Ie214f0713cef779307d3379df81e2b95115b6d6d Signed-off-by: halil.cakal <halil.cakal@est.tech>